Transaction 66b91ba3f48b143bd8bf65b657202a5292c18668cf0fb6dfed46f02b85361f4d

1 Input
2 Outputs
  • 66b91ba3f48b143bd8bf65b657202a5292c18668cf0fb6dfed46f02b85361f4d:0
  • value  869100
    address  37YoTmmR7c68BimMDLGGb3SyjfZjFyb9oT
  • 66b91ba3f48b143bd8bf65b657202a5292c18668cf0fb6dfed46f02b85361f4d:1
  • value  37486110
    address  1GthDXiGsSyDyhRgk8NzupYNVxRDhZetN5